Abstract

L’invention concerne un module photovoltaïque (2), comportant, entre une face avant (4) et une face arrière (14) une ou des cellules photovoltaïques (6, 8), des couches d’encapsulation (10, 11) de cette ou ces cellules, au moins un élément (20) conducteur ou semi-conducteur disposé entre la ou les cellules (6, 8) et la face arrière (14) du module, et des moyens (22) formant contact pour une mise à un potentiel de cet élément conducteur ou semi-conducteur.
